Get To Know Hydravent®

Hydravent® is an innovative and cost-effective ventilation system for naturally occurring gases such as methane, radon, and soil gases.
Hydravent is a series of collector lines, systematically spaced, that are connected to vents. It acts as an absorption material beneath liners and vents gases in a controlled, efficient, and safe manner. By using components of the proven Hydraway drainage system, this venting system realizes unparalleled strength, an industry-leading in-flow rate, and a history of long life. Using Hydravent as a flow path for gases prevents damage caused by these gases, such as lifting or tearing of a liner beneath a water retention pond.

Hydravent Applications
Hydravent works across a wide range of applications where naturally occurring gases need to be managed safely and efficiently. Here are the most common uses for the system.
- Pond or lagoon liners: Prevents gas buildup that can lift or damage liners over time.
- Landfills: Vents gases produced by decomposing waste materials.
- Water treatment facilities: Manages gases that accumulate during treatment processes.
- Wastewater management: Handles gas venting in wastewater infrastructure projects.
- Mining: Supports safe gas management at active and reclaimed mining sites.
- Petroleum facilities: Vents gases associated with petroleum storage and handling.
- Fish hatcheries: Manages soil and water related gases at hatchery installations.
- Brownfields: Addresses gases at reclaimed industrial and contaminated sites.
- Subways: Vents methane and other gases in underground transit infrastructure.

Installing Hydravent
Hydravent is rolled out in a pattern and is covered by a liner, and it is specifically designed with no memory so it easily keeps its shape while the liner is installed. Taking advantage of gravity and slope, Hydravent follows the contours of the area being vented, while the collector lines are oriented in the direction that offers a path of least resistance to the high point. The system is usually spaced at 15 to 20 foot intervals, creating a grid for collection and removal of gases across the entire installation area.
Hydravent comes in widths of 6 and 12 inches, with a standard length of 150 feet, though it can be customized in a variety of lengths and widths upon request to meet the specific needs of each project. Vent Manifold
The vent manifold system design is used when individual vents are not desirable, are not aesthetically pleasing, or are prevented by local codes. In these situations, a manifold is constructed around the perimeter of the installation, giving contractors a cleaner look and a centralized way to collect and transport the vented gases. This approach keeps the surface of the site free from multiple visible vents while still delivering the gas management performance the project requires.
PVC and Schedule 40 pipe are used to transport gas through the manifold system, which makes the setup compatible with widely available materials and simplifies the sourcing and installation process.

Vent Stack
The vent stack system design is used to vent collected gases to the atmosphere while protecting the system from the elements and weather conditions. Vent stacks are connected at the highest point of the collector lines, where they take full advantage of gravity and pressure to move gases up and out of the system efficiently.
This design is straightforward, reliable, and well suited to projects where visible venting is acceptable or preferred.
Like the manifold system, the vent stack design is compatible with PVC and Schedule 40 pipe, which keeps the installation simple and cost effective.

Hydravent Installation Project Highlight
Project Name – Airport methane venting
Location – Newark, NJ
Industry / Sector – Transportation
Project Summary – Hydravent was used to vent methane gas buildup in walkway tunnel.
Product Type – Hydravent
Project Challenges – Design of venting system that would channel methane gases.
It was determined that methane gas was present in the new walkway tunnel. The specifying engineering firm out of New York City chose Hydravent to mitigate the methane from the tunnel after extensive testing on this high profile project.
As a material supplier, we worked closely with the specifying engineer to provide data and certifications. Intech Anchoring Systems also assisted in the development of customized fittings for the specific use case on this project.
Hydravent Venting System, including the customized fittings, was chosen due to the extremely high in-flow rate of methane gases. With Hydravent’s compressive strength, the system was tested to failure and proved an excellent option for this project.
Hydravent performed as expected and continues to perform exceptionally well. The customized fittings worked as designed. Hydravent was installed with 25-foot spacing on the outside of the tunnel walls that went up and over the wall. The project was completed on time with the expected results.
